FastCopy is a file management tool that dramatically increases copying and pasting speeds. While your computer is probably fast enough with smaller pasting projects, this program helps when you're pasting larger files like videos, databases and images. It has a simple user interface that anyone will be able to use after just a few minutes.

Basic Features

FastCopy is a file management and transfer program that is capable of copying and moving files faster than your computer normally can. Many people use the copy and paste feature on their computer. This is very fast when you're copying something small like a single document or even a sentence from one document to place in another. It gets slower though if you're trying to copy and paste a folder or larger movie file.

A program like FastCopy speeds up this process. While estimates vary, this program is about twice as fast at copying and moving documents. That's a huge time save when you transferring hundreds of megabytes or gigabytes.

Another time save occurs when bad files are found. Normally your computer will stop the entire pasting process when a bad file comes up and will demand your attention before going back to work. FastCopy skips over these files until the end so that all the other files can be copied and moved without slowing down the process.

User Interface

The user interface is simple for the most part. While there are some confusing features best left to advanced users, the basic feature of copying and moving files is very simple. Simply select the "Copy/Move Option" listing, choose the directory to be copied, tell the program where to place the files and it will get to work. There is no maximum size, so you can do this with folders that are incredibly large.

If you stick to the basic features, then you'll find that FastCopy is a simple program that anyone can use. This should only take you minutes to learn and you'll find that it's very useful. If you try using the other features like Drive Setting, Shell Extensions and Log Settings, then the program becomes a little more involved. The good news is that you don't need to play with these features if you don't want to.

Checking the Log

If you're moving larger files, then you probably want to keep track of which files were already moved and where they were placed. Copying the file again could take a lot of time. FastCopy has a detailed log that shows all the actions that were performed.

The log not only shows which files were copied and when, but it also shows if the transfer properly happened. Sometimes files are corrupted or there is an error when transferring them. The log will show if this happened. You can use this if a file seems to be missing or if you're not sure if something was copied already.

Poor Help File

Most programs come with documentation or a help file that can answer questions for you. These documents are often good if you are having problems with a tool or if the interface is confusing. FastCopy's help file tends to be on the cryptic side. It doesn't give you much information. Not only that, but it seems to be written more for advanced users.
